Lifting the Infrastructure: Analyzing the Mobile Crane Market
The size of the mobile crane market is expected to grow to US$ 30,804.3 million by the year 2031 from US$ 19,637.58 million in 2023.
The market for mobile cranes, the backbone of heavy lifting and construction operations, is witnessing vibrant expansion fueled by growth in infrastructure, urbanization, and the heightening complexity of construction activities. These multi-talented machines, with heavy lifting capabilities and the ability to traverse varied ground conditions, are essential for applications across a vast spectrum.
This market is experiencing a consistent upward curve, supported by worldwide infrastructure spending. The market will exhibit a CAGR of 5.8% from 2023–2031. This growth is attributed directly to the growing construction, energy, and logistic industries.
One of the main factors contributing to this market is the growth in infrastructure projects. The government all over the world is spending a lot of money on the development of infrastructure like roads, bridges, and buildings, which demands lifting and setting heavy loads using mobile cranes. The development in renewable energy projects like wind farms also increases the demand for high-capacity mobile cranes.
The increasing urbanization and the construction of skyscrapers are also propelling the market to greater heights. Mobile cranes are essential to hoist and place materials in elevated positions, enabling the development of modern-day skyscrapers and city developments.
Technological innovation is enhancing the performance and productivity of mobile cranes. The use of digital technologies such as telematics, remote monitoring, and sophisticated control systems is improving operating efficiency, safety, and maintenance. The use of hybrid and electric mobile cranes is also on the horizon, driven by sustainability requirements and emission reduction wishes.
But the market is not free of challenges. Economic recessions, particularly in the construction sector, can influence demand. Harsh safety regulations and the need for experienced operators are also challenges. Moreover, the cost of high-tech mobile cranes may be out of reach for some contractors.
The industry is dominated by a combination of established producers and niche suppliers with a variety of mobile cranes of different capacities and configurations available. Competition arises based on factors like lifting capacity, reach, mobility, fuel efficiency, and safety features.
In the coming years, the mobile crane market will continue to be strong due to ongoing growth in infrastructure development and rising complexity of construction operations. Adoption of advanced technologies like automation and artificial intelligence will continue to improve the performance and functionality of the mobile cranes. Creation of specialized mobile cranes for particular applications, like offshore wind farm installation, will also create new opportunities.
